When a pull request originates from this repository, the verify workflow will run ./.github/scripts/autoupdate-scripts-sha.sh to update .sha256 files for changed scripts under docs/perfsonar/tools_scripts. This ensures the "Verify docs -> site script sync" job does not fail because .sha files are out-of-date in the PR. The step only runs for same-repo PRs to avoid committing to forks.
